
It's Where Are You, Lillie? It's a five hander, is written by Mary Conway, whose "For The Love of Michael" proved such a success in April 2009, and is equally as powerful. I know. I read it. I don't want to give too much away, but it's a family drama with a contemporary theme of Islamophobia lurking underneath, set among the type of people who eat salads out of wooden bowls.
We've all met them.
So, 7.45 at the Phoenix.
